What is a Compact Vacuum Circuit Breaker?
A Compact Vacuum Circuit Breaker (CVCB) is an electrical device used to protect circuits from overloads and short circuits. Unlike traditional air-insulated circuit breakers, CVCBs use a vacuum as an insulating medium, which allows for more efficient operation and compact design. These breakers are often used in substations and industrial applications where space is limited.

How does a Compact Vacuum Circuit Breaker work?
CVCBs operate by using a vacuum to extinguish the arc that occurs when interrupting an electrical current. Here’s how the process works:
- Current Flow: When electricity flows through the circuit, the circuit breaker remains closed, allowing current to pass.
- Fault Detection: If a fault occurs, such as a short circuit, the CVCB detects the increase in current.
- Arc Quenching: The breaker opens the circuit, creating an arc. The vacuum inside the breaker rapidly extinguishes this arc, preventing damage to the system.
- Restoration: Once the fault is cleared, the breaker can be closed again, restoring power to the circuit.

What applications are best suited for Compact Vacuum Circuit Breakers?
CVCBs are versatile and can be used in various applications:
- Industrial Plants: Ideal for protecting motors and transformers in factories.
- Power Distribution: Used in substations for managing electricity distribution.
- Renewable Energy Projects: Effective in solar and wind energy systems to enhance reliability.
- Commercial Buildings: Suitable for managing electrical systems in offices and skyscrapers.
